Dune is a 1984 American epic space opera film written and directed by David Lynch and based on the 1965 Frank Herbert novel Dune. It was filmed at the Churubusco Studios in Mexico City. The soundtrack was composed by the rock band Toto, with a contribution from Brian Eno.

Dune is a 1984 motion picture directed by David Lynch and based on the 1965 Frank Herbert novel of the same name. The film stars Kyle MacLachlan in his debut role as Paul Atreides, and includes an ensemble of well-known American, Latin American, and European actors in supporting roles, including...
